linux命令中可以用以查看内存使用的有
-
在Linux命令中,可以使用以下命令来查看内存使用情况:
1. free命令:该命令用于显示系统内存的使用情况,包括内存总量、已用内存、空闲内存等。
2. top命令:该命令可以监视系统的实时性能情况,其中包括了内存的使用情况。
3. vmstat命令:通过vmstat命令可以获得系统的内存使用情况,包括内存总量、空闲内存、缓冲区、缓存等。
4. cat /proc/meminfo命令:该命令可以查看系统的内存信息,包括内存总量、空闲内存、缓冲区、缓存等。
5. ps命令:通过ps命令可以查看正在运行的进程的内存使用情况,通过参数如RSS、VSZ可以查看进程的实际物理内存使用情况。
以上就是一些常用的Linux命令来查看内存使用情况的方法,使用这些命令可以对系统的内存情况有一个全面的了解。
2年前 -
在Linux系统中,有多种命令可以用来查看内存的使用情况。以下是几个常用的命令:
1. free:该命令用于显示系统中的内存使用情况,包括总内存、已用内存、空闲内存、缓存和缓冲区使用情况等。运行命令”free”即可显示内存信息。
2. top:top命令用于实时显示系统中各个资源的使用情况,包括内存、CPU、进程等。在top命令的输出结果中,可以看到内存的使用情况,包括总内存、已用内存、空闲内存、缓存和缓冲区的使用情况等。
3. vmstat:vmstat命令可以报告虚拟内存的统计信息,包括内存的使用情况、虚拟内存和交换空间的活动情况等。运行命令”vmstat”即可显示vmstat的输出结果。
4. sar:sar命令用于收集系统的运行情况,并生成报告。sar命令可以显示内存使用的统计信息,包括平均内存使用率、缓存和缓冲区的使用情况等。运行命令”sar -r”可以显示内存使用的报告。
5. smem:smem是一个用于报告系统内存使用的工具,可以显示进程和内存的详细信息。smem命令输出的结果包括每个进程的内存使用、共享内存、私有内存和内存值等信息。
以上是几个常用的Linux命令用于查看内存使用的情况,可以根据实际需要选择使用。通过这些命令,可以方便地监控系统的内存使用情况,提供了对系统性能的评估和优化的参考。
2年前 -
在Linux中,你可以使用许多命令来查看内存使用情况。下面是一些常用的命令:
1. free命令
free命令用于显示系统内存的整体使用情况,包括物理内存和交换空间的使用情况。它可以提供内存的总量、已使用量、剩余量以及缓存和缓冲区的使用情况。2. top命令
top命令是一个动态实时监控系统性能的工具。它可以显示各个进程的资源使用情况,包括内存、CPU、进程数量等等。在top命令中,你可以按’M’键来按内存使用量排序,以找出消耗最多内存的进程。3. htop命令
htop是一个交互式的进程查看器,功能类似于top命令。它可以提供更详细的系统信息,并以彩色界面展示。在htop中,你可以按F6键选择按内存使用量排序进程。4. ps命令
ps命令用于列出运行在系统中的进程。通过使用不同的选项,你可以显示各个进程的内存使用情况。例如,使用”ps aux”命令可以显示所有进程的详细信息,包括内存使用量。5. pmap命令
pmap命令用于显示进程的内存映射情况,包括使用的内存大小、权限、起始地址等等。通过指定进程的PID,你可以查看特定进程的内存使用情况。6. vmstat命令
vmstat命令用于监控系统的虚拟内存、进程、CPU和I/O统计信息。通过使用不同的选项,你可以显示内存使用量、缓冲区和交换空间的使用情况。7. top命令的”-e”选项
使用top命令时,你可以使用”-e”选项来显示进程的详细内存使用信息。在top界面中,按shift + e组合键可以切换到详细内存模式,显示每个进程使用的实际物理内存大小。以上是一些常用的Linux命令,在查看内存使用情况时非常有用。根据具体的需求,你可以选择适合自己的命令来监控和分析系统的内存使用情况。
2年前